About M. Ziyaeifar

M. Ziyaeifar is a scholar working on Civil and Structural Engineering, General Engineering and Computational Mechanics, having authored 23 papers that have together received 398 indexed citations. Recurring topics across this work include Seismic Performance and Analysis (12 papers), Structural Health Monitoring Techniques (5 papers) and Vibration Control and Rheological Fluids (5 papers). The work is most often cited by research in Civil and Structural Engineering (274 citations), Computational Mechanics (179 citations) and Ocean Engineering (67 citations). M. Ziyaeifar has collaborated with scholars based in Iran, Canada and Japan. Frequent co-authors include Hiroshi Noguchi, M. R. Soghrat, Alaa E. Elwi, Nicola Moraci, Abdolreza S. Moghadam and Adolfo Santini. Their work appears in journals such as Bulletin of the Seismological Society of America, Journal of Sound and Vibration and Engineering Structures.
